Patents by Inventor Donglin Wang

Donglin Wang has filed for patents to protect the following inventions. This listing includes patent applications that are pending as well as patents that have already been granted by the United States Patent and Trademark Office (USPTO).

  • Publication number: 20230308789
    Abstract: A signal processing method and apparatus, and a communication system, and relates to the field of communication technologies. The method includes: a processing unit of a first device first determines a distortion parameter of an eye pattern of a first PAM-N signal transmitted by a transmitting unit in the first device, then performs anti-distortion preprocessing on a second PAM-N signal using an equalizer based on the distortion parameter, to obtain a third PAM-N signal, and controls the transmitting unit to transmit the third PAM-N signal. The distortion parameter is for reflecting a tilt status of the eye pattern, and N?2. The equalizer is used to perform anti-distortion preprocessing on the second PAM-N signal to obtain the third PAM-N signal.
    Type: Application
    Filed: June 2, 2023
    Publication date: September 28, 2023
    Applicant: HUAWEI TECHNOLOGIES CO., LTD.
    Inventors: Yu TIAN, Donglin WANG
  • Publication number: 20230208634
    Abstract: Disclosed are a key management method and a key management apparatus, where the key management method includes: acquiring authorization of a user through a first identity authentication mode to generate a first authentication encryption key, where the first identity authentication mode is used for logging into a digital identity; and encrypting at least one character decryption key by using the first authentication encryption key to obtain at least one initially encrypted character decryption key corresponding to the first identity authentication mode, where the at least one character decryption key is in a one-to-one correspondence with at least one character of the digital identity and used to decrypt at least one encrypted target key to obtain at least one target key. In the technical solutions of the present application, an identity authentication mode can be associated with a target key, facilitating a management and use process of the target key.
    Type: Application
    Filed: February 28, 2023
    Publication date: June 29, 2023
    Applicant: Beijing Sursen Information Technology Co., Ltd.
    Inventor: Donglin WANG
  • Publication number: 20230208637
    Abstract: Disclosed are a key management method and a key management apparatus. The method includes: after confirming that a user logs into a digital identity through a first identity authentication mode, acquiring a first character decryption key corresponding to a first character in at least one character of the digital identity; and decrypting, based on the first character decryption key, an encrypted target key stored in the digital identity to obtain a target key, where the target key is used to manage an asset corresponding to the first character. Based on the technical solutions provided in the present application, a user can log into a digital identity through existing identity information and implement asset management without memorizing a cumbersome and complicated key, which provides great convenience for the user.
    Type: Application
    Filed: February 28, 2023
    Publication date: June 29, 2023
    Applicant: Beijing Sursen Information Technology Co., Ltd.
    Inventor: Donglin WANG
  • Publication number: 20210218419
    Abstract: The present application provides a method, a device and an apparatus for storing data, and a computer readable storage medium. The method includes: dividing the data into X data fragments for forming an array including m rows and n columns, each of the rows including at least one and at most n data fragments, and each of the columns including at least one and at most m data fragments; encoding at least one of the data fragments in the each of the rows using an error correction code encoding algorithm to obtain M row check fragments, and encoding at least one of the data fragments in the each of the columns using an error correction code encoding algorithm to obtain N column check fragments, wherein M?m, N?n; and storing the X data fragments, the M row check fragments and the N column check fragments.
    Type: Application
    Filed: January 11, 2021
    Publication date: July 15, 2021
    Inventor: Donglin WANG
  • Publication number: 20210209131
    Abstract: A method for data synchronization of multiple nodes includes: receiving, by a master node in at least one master node in the multiple nodes, a write operation submitted by an application program; packaging, by the master node, at least one data change log corresponding to the write operation into a block generated by the master node, and signing the block; broadcasting, by the master node, the block to other nodes in the multiple nodes after signing the block; reading, by at least one synchronous node in the multiple nodes, the at least one data change log in the block, and executing at least one data change operation corresponding to the at least one data change log in the block; and determining, by at least one node in the multiple nodes, an operation state of the block.
    Type: Application
    Filed: January 6, 2021
    Publication date: July 8, 2021
    Inventor: Donglin WANG
  • Patent number: 10782898
    Abstract: The embodiments of the present invention relate to a storage system comprising: a storage network; at least two storage nodes, connected to the storage network; and at least one storage device, connected to the storage network, each storage device comprising at least one storage medium; wherein, the storage network is configured to enable each of the at least two storage nodes to access any of the at least one storage medium without passing through another storage node of the at least two storage nodes. According to the embodiments of the present invention, a storage system in which there is no need to physically migrate data when rebalancing is required is provided.
    Type: Grant
    Filed: September 24, 2018
    Date of Patent: September 22, 2020
    Assignee: SURCLOUD CORP.
    Inventors: Donglin Wang, Youbing Jin, Zhonghua Mo
  • Publication number: 20190235777
    Abstract: A redundant storage system which can automatically recover RAID data by crossing different JBODs includes: at least one server, Non-Ethernet network including at least one Non-Ethernet switch, and at least two storage devices; each of the at least one server includes an interface card, and each of the at least one server is connected to the at least one Non-Ethernet switch through a Port of the interface card; each of the at least two storage devices is connected to the at least one Non-Ethernet switch through an Interface; each of the at least two storage devices includes at least one physical storage medium; physical storage mediums respectively included in different storage devices constitute a RAID group.
    Type: Application
    Filed: April 8, 2019
    Publication date: August 1, 2019
    Inventor: Donglin Wang
  • Patent number: 10332239
    Abstract: The present invention provides apparatus and method for parallel polyphase image interpolation.
    Type: Grant
    Filed: June 12, 2015
    Date of Patent: June 25, 2019
    Assignee: Institute of Automation Chinese Academy of Sciences
    Inventors: Ruoshan Guo, Lei Wang, Rui Han, Chen Lin, Donglin Wang
  • Publication number: 20190028542
    Abstract: The embodiments of the present invention provide a method and a device for transmitting data, which can improve the efficiency of data transmission greatly. The method for transmitting data is used in storage systems including shared storage pools, the method includes: receiving a data transmission request sent by an application program located at same physical server; storing the data to be transmitted in a shared storage pool of a storage system; and packaging the storage address of the data stored and sending the data package by a network protocol.
    Type: Application
    Filed: September 25, 2018
    Publication date: January 24, 2019
    Inventors: Donglin WANG, Youbing JIN
  • Publication number: 20190026039
    Abstract: The embodiments of the present invention relate to a storage system comprising: a storage network; at least two storage nodes, connected to the storage network; and at least one storage device, connected to the storage network, each storage device comprising at least one storage medium; wherein, the storage network is configured to enable each of the at least two storage nodes to access any of the at least one storage medium without passing through another storage node of the at least two storage nodes. According to the embodiments of the present invention, a storage system in which there is no need to physically migrate data when rebalancing is required is provided.
    Type: Application
    Filed: September 24, 2018
    Publication date: January 24, 2019
    Inventors: Donglin WANG, Youbing JIN, Zhonghua MO
  • Publication number: 20180341419
    Abstract: The embodiments of the present invention relate to a storage system comprising: a storage network; at least two storage nodes, connected to the storage network; and at least one storage device, connected to the storage network, each storage device comprising at least one storage medium; wherein, the storage network is configured to enable each storage node to access all the storage mediums without passing through other storage nodes. According to the embodiments of the present invention, a storage system in which there is no need to physically move data when rebalancing is required is provided.
    Type: Application
    Filed: August 3, 2018
    Publication date: November 29, 2018
    Inventors: Donglin WANG, Youbing JIN
  • Patent number: 9966932
    Abstract: An apparatus for parallel filtering, including a multi-granularity memory, a data cache device, a coefficient buffer broadcast device, a vector operation device and a command queue device. The multi-granularity memory is configured to store data to be filtered, filter coefficients and filtering result data. The data cache device is configured to cache, read and update the data to be filtered. The coefficient buffer broadcast device is configured to cache and broadcast the read filter coefficients. The command queue device is configured to store and output a queue of operation commands for the parallel filtering operation. The vector operation device is configured to perform a vector operation based on the data to be filtered and the output coefficient data, and write an operation result into the multi-granularity filtering result storage unit. A method is also provided.
    Type: Grant
    Filed: April 19, 2013
    Date of Patent: May 8, 2018
    Assignee: BEIJING SMARTLOGIC TECHNOLOGY LTD.
    Inventors: Donglin Wang, Leizu Yin, Yongyong Yang, Shaolin Xie, Tao Wang
  • Publication number: 20180108113
    Abstract: The present invention provides apparatus and method for parallel polyphase image interpolation.
    Type: Application
    Filed: June 12, 2015
    Publication date: April 19, 2018
    Inventors: Ruoshan GUO, Lei WANG, Rui HAN, Chen LIN, Donglin WANG
  • Publication number: 20180083954
    Abstract: The present invention provides a method, system and login device for logging into a docbase management system. the method includes: establishing a login device which has a unified invocation interface; invoking, by a user, the login device via an application software unit, wherein the application software unit invokes the login device via the unified invocation interface; returning, by the login device, to the application software unit, access information of a role corresponding to the user achieved after successfully logging in the docbase management system; accessing, by the application software unit, the docbase management system by using the access information.
    Type: Application
    Filed: November 2, 2017
    Publication date: March 22, 2018
    Inventor: Donglin WANG
  • Publication number: 20170249093
    Abstract: Embodiments of the present invention provide a storage method and a distributed storage system. The storage method is applied to the distributed storage system comprising at least two storage control nodes and one storage pool shared by at least two storage control nodes. The storage pool includes at least two storage units. When data is to be written to the storage pool by any one of storage control nodes, the method comprises judging whether or not there exists a duplicate storage unit whose data content is the same as the currently-written data in the storage pool, and allocating one free storage unit from the storage pool and writing the currently-written data to the free storage unit when judgment result is NO.
    Type: Application
    Filed: May 12, 2017
    Publication date: August 31, 2017
    Inventors: Donglin WANG, Yu QI
  • Publication number: 20160233850
    Abstract: The present disclosure provides a method and apparatus for parallel filtering. The apparatus comprises: a multi-granularity memory, a data cache device, a coefficient buffer broadcast device, a vector operation device and a command queue device. The multi-granularity memory is configured to store data to be filtered, filter coefficients and filtering result data. The data cache device is configured to cache, read and update the data to be filtered. The coefficient buffer broadcast device is configured to cache and broadcast the read filter coefficients. The command queue device is configured to store and output a queue of operation commands for the parallel filtering operation. The vector operation device is configured to perform a vector operation based on the data to be filtered and the output coefficient data, and write an operation result into the multi-granularity filtering result storage unit.
    Type: Application
    Filed: April 19, 2013
    Publication date: August 11, 2016
    Inventors: Donglin Wang, Leizu Yin, Yongyong Yang, Shaolin Xie, Tao Wang
  • Patent number: 9396348
    Abstract: A system and method for electronic stamping are disclosed. Personal fingerprint pre-stored is used to verify the fingerprint information collected, the document data and the fingerprint information is signed with a private key to get a first signature result, the user's public key and the pre-stored fingerprint information is then signed with a private key of a stamp producer to get a second signature result, the first signature result, the collected fingerprint information and the second signature result are combined to form electronic fingerprint stamp data.
    Type: Grant
    Filed: September 19, 2014
    Date of Patent: July 19, 2016
    Assignee: TIANJIN SURSEN INVESTMENT CO., LTD.
    Inventors: Youbing Jin, Donglin Wang
  • Publication number: 20160182638
    Abstract: A data storage system comprises at least one subsystem. Each subsystem includes at least two physical servers and at least two storage devices. Each physical server is connected to at least one storage device through a direct channel, and a part of storage medium in each storage device are used as a master storage area, another part of the storage medium in each storage device are used as a slave storage area. When data is written to the data storage system, the data is written to the master storage area of a certain storage device connected to a certain physical server in a certain subsystem, and is synchronized to the slave storage area of another storage device connected to anther physical server. A corresponding cloud serving method is disclosed.
    Type: Application
    Filed: February 26, 2016
    Publication date: June 23, 2016
    Inventors: Youbing JIN, Donglin WANG
  • Publication number: 20160162290
    Abstract: The present disclosure provides a processor having polymorphic instruction set architecture. The processor comprises a scalar processing unit, at least one polymorphic instruction processing unit, at least one multi-granularity parallel memory and a DMA controller. The polymorphic instruction processing unit comprises at least one functional unit. The polymorphic instruction processing unit is configured to interpret and execute a polymorphic instruction and the functional unit is configured to perform specific data operation tasks. The scalar processing unit is configured to invoke the polymorphic instruction and inquire an execution state of the polymorphic instruction. The DMA controller is configured to transmit configuration information for the polymorphic instruction and transmit data required by the polymorphic instruction to the multi-granularity parallel memory.
    Type: Application
    Filed: April 19, 2013
    Publication date: June 9, 2016
    Inventors: Donglin Wang, Shaolin Xie, Yongyong Yang, Leizu Yin, Lei Wang, Zijun Liu, Tao Wang, Xing Zhang
  • Publication number: 20160112413
    Abstract: A method for controlling security of cloud storage is developed to solve the problem in the prior art that the private key has a low security since the provider of the cloud storage service needs to control the private key in the case of sharing storage. The method comprises: encrypting a private key assigned to a user with two different encryption modes to obtain a first key and a second key and storing the first key and the second key; receiving an answer to a security question inputted by the user when decrypting the first key with a user password fails, and decrypting the second key with the answer to the security question to obtain the private key; and resetting the user password, encrypting the private key obtained by decryption with the answer to the security question to obtain a new first key.
    Type: Application
    Filed: November 17, 2015
    Publication date: April 21, 2016
    Inventor: Donglin WANG